I did the following trade this week.
I give: Lee & Brate
I get: Cobb
My thinking: With Jordy gone I think Cobb bounces back this year. Had to diversify too from all my JAG players with Moncreif landing there. Also thinking Brate will drive me crazy with inconsistency due to Howard and I'm deep at TE.
Excited to have a pass catcher from Rodgers. Classic buy low opportunity in my mind.

I'd anticipate Lee and Cobb to be roughly equal in PPR, so I'd have to take the Brate side. BUT, I can understand wanting a piece of a Rodgers led offense and with Jordy gone there is a small chance Cobb bounces back, so Brate is a relatively small price to pay to see how it plays out (And you have TE depth). Just completed for Team 2 in my sig..PPR league.
Sent: S. Perine, N. Agholor
Received: D. Funchess, 3.05 (devy league, so pick is equivalent to 4th round pick in a standard league).
I already have Alshon and Ajayi so I have enough Eagles from a fantasy perspective, although Agholor is quite decent in PPR. Perine, I'm hedging my bets on and was scared off by the recent news blurbs saying they plan to take a RB in the draft (which makes sense). Also with only 2 good games last year he could be written out of the offense (also little appeal in PPR with Thompson around and Perine's skillset). Funchess will have additional competition this year no doubt, but played well last year so I wanted to take a shot. Funchess has a higher ceiling imo.

I like this deal. I admit, even though he may not be “exciting” per se, but I like Funchess more than most. To me, there’s a lot to like, first, he’s their #1WR and it doesn’t look like they are going to upgrade much at WR, secondly, he’s really young and came into his own last season. I was surprised about Agholor, I probably gave up on him too quick but he definitely showed that he belongs in this league but out of Funchess or Agholor, I’m taking Funchess rather easily. The only way I see you losing this deal is if Perine has a monster season but that’s a total wildcard right now.
